The cricket season is just around the corner and the committee have been working hard behind the scenes to ensure that we have a positive and successful season. We have the opening of the new clubrooms so this will be an exciting time to be a part of Sunbury Cricket Club, so watch this space!!!

This season we again see Travis Botten leading us as President and also Marty Kelders as Secretary. Matt Ward has taken over the Treasurers role after it was vacated by the hard working Mick Corcoran, and we have a couple of new additions to the committee in Alex Bonacci and Dwayne Bottomley and Vice President and Jnr Vice President respectively. The current committee would like to thank last years’ committee for all the hard work that they put in, without it the club would not have ran as smoothly as it did. The committee would also like to congratulate and thank our new coach Justin Nelson. As everyone knows Justin is a much loved bloke around the club and we are looking forward to seeing his “serious” side. We know he is hard at work getting ready for a big pre-season, so keep an eye out for any information.

This season the Committee have been forced to raise subs however we will be providing more for the players. Senior players subs will include; all umpires fees, all ball money, a blue club shirt and your choice of ONE of the following; A white playing shirt, our new style club shorts or a training singlet.

The prices are:

FULL SENIOR – $280                      STUDENT / APPRENTICE – $180

We will be running the Player sponsorship again this season. If you can find a local business to pay all or part of your subs we will promote them to our members on our webpage or even a photo on our social media pages.

Players that owe from last season will be approached to finalise their subs. A payment agreement will not be made with anyone that has outstanding payments from previous seasons. If you wish to enter a paying agreement please speak to Matt Ward before the first game as from Christmas we will not be accepting excuses from players that have not bothered to speak to us earlier. We are also able to accept Credit Card payments this year, so if you don’t have cash, it’s no worries, we can just swipe your card!!!

Senior and Junior coaching 2016/17 – Expressions of interest


SCC Logo 2015

On the back of a successful cricket season Sunbury Cricket Club are seeking expressions of interest for Senior and Junior coaches for next season.

Senior Coaching

There is an exciting opportunity to coach a club with very strong depth in young players and to lead a senior team with a mixture of seasoned cricketers and stars of the future. Our 1st XI has never been short of on field leadership with dual Kevin Sullivan Medalist, current GDCA Team of the Year Captain and Aggregates Award winner  Jason McGann, ably supported by experienced players Heath Boffey and Paul Webber.

What a great opportunity for an aspiring cricketer to lead a first grade club as a coach and senior player and take our club to the next level. A coach offering leadership, a structured approach to training in an inclusive environment would be considered favourably.

If your are an experienced first grade cricketer and are looking for a new challenge or if you are new player to the area please contact us, this is certainly going to be the place to be in 2016/17.

New club room facilities are currently being built and will be in use at the start of the season. Already the envy of the competition playing at the home of sport in Sunbury, the Clarke Oval, our new home will be a revelation.

McMahon Sports Pavilion Redevelopment

Pavilion hume pic

Junior Coaching

Junior coaches are very important roles within our club, we are looking for those who have an interest in cricket development and coordination at training and on game day. Without volunteers these programs are not possible so even if you have little experience we can provide assistance, there is always a role for those at any level. Scorers and team managers are also valuable to the team, many hands make light work.

We are looking to again run U16’s, U14’s, U12’s, U11’s and the Milo program.

T20 Blast is another program we would love to run if we can get assistance.

SCC welcome expressions of interest from parents and care providers who simply like to participate in their child’s activities. You don’t really need to be a former or current player to join in the fun.

If you are attending a match and would like to assist or help out for the day, don’t be shy, step forward and introduce yourself to our coach. We pride ourselves on being a family oriented club so that means we like to see the whole family getting involved.

Particularly if you are an interested parent and see yourself in a coaching role or simply would like to contribute we would love to hear from you.

Milo cricket is one coordination position open, without your help it may not be possible to run this program, so please get in contact with the club so we can make 2016/17 even bigger and better.

Welcome

The Sunbury Cricket Club has a long and proud history traceable back to the 1870’s and has been competing in the Gisborne District Cricket Association since the 1923/24 season.

We are a community minded club, fostering the growth of cricket and a healthy lifestyle. Our home is the Clarke Oval arguably the premier cricket ground in the district and we have access to the facilities of the Sunbury Football Social Club restaurant, function room and sports bar. We offer something for cricketers of all ages and the whole family.

With summer fast approaching, we are on the lookout for new players for the 2013/14 season. Our aim is to go one better in our pursuit of the GDCA McIntyre Cup as the previous seasons runners up. We welcome players for all senior grades and any junior players to come down and enjoy the fun of cricket in a positive environment.
